The Benefits Of Lyophilised Products

Lyophilisation, also known as freeze-drying, is a process that involves removing water from a product after it has been frozen and placing it in a vacuum. This process results in a wide range of products such as food, pharmaceuticals, and biological materials being transformed into a stable, lightweight, and long-lasting form. In recent years, lyophilised products have gained popularity due to their numerous benefits.

One of the main advantages of lyophilised products is their extended shelf life. By removing water from the product, the risk of microbial growth and spoilage is greatly reduced. This results in lyophilised products having a much longer shelf life compared to their non-lyophilised counterparts. This is especially beneficial for food products, as it allows for easier storage and transportation without the need for refrigeration.

Another benefit of lyophilised products is their lightweight nature. By removing water from the product, the overall weight is greatly reduced. This is particularly advantageous in industries such as pharmaceuticals and space travel, where weight and space are crucial factors. lyophilised products are also easier to transport and store due to their lightweight nature, making them a more cost-effective option.

In addition to their extended shelf life and lightweight nature, lyophilised products also maintain their original properties and characteristics. The freeze-drying process results in minimal damage to the product, preserving its flavor, texture, and nutritional value. This is especially important in the food industry, where consumers expect high-quality products that taste fresh and delicious.

lyophilised products are also easy to rehydrate, making them convenient to use. Whether it is food, pharmaceuticals, or biological materials, lyophilised products can be easily reconstituted with the addition of water. This makes them versatile and suitable for a wide range of applications. For example, lyophilised food products can be quickly rehydrated and cooked, while pharmaceuticals can be easily reconstituted for administration.

Furthermore, lyophilised products are more stable compared to traditional products. The freeze-drying process removes water from the product, preventing chemical reactions that can lead to degradation. This results in lyophilised products retaining their potency and effectiveness for a longer period of time. In the pharmaceutical industry, this stability is crucial for ensuring the efficacy of drugs and vaccines.

lyophilised products also have a lower risk of contamination. The freeze-drying process effectively eliminates water, which is essential for microbial growth. This reduces the risk of contamination and ensures the safety of the product. In industries such as pharmaceuticals and food, where product safety is paramount, lyophilised products offer a reliable and secure option.
